Start With Licensing, Permits, And Real Local Experience

A slick brochure does not tell you whether a contractor is qualified to work on your home. Before you compare price or brand names, make sure the contractor is licensed, insured, and familiar with the type of home you have.

That matters because window work is not only about setting a frame in an opening. Because permit rules and inspection practices vary across Alabama, local experience matters when the project needs approvals before the work starts.

What Should Be In A Serious Installation Estimate

A real estimate should read like a scope of work, not a single lump sum with a brand name attached. A complete estimate should break out the window units, labor, trim or finish carpentry, disposal, flashing materials, and any allowance for damaged framing.

Without that detail, the lowest number can turn into the most expensive job once change orders begin. Installation Quality Is In The Flashing And The Details

Even a premium window can fail if the crew handles the opening badly. That is why you want a contractor who talks about flashing, air sealing, and moisture barriers before the first unit is set.

Ask what happens if the opening is damaged or not square. If a contractor waves those questions away, keep shopping. On window replacement for older homes Madison AL projects, the prep work often takes as much judgment as the installation itself.

Warranty language deserves attention. If the contractor cannot clearly separate product warranty from installation warranty, press for specifics.

Comparing Bids Without Fixating On The Lowest Number

The cheapest bid is not automatically the best value. A slightly higher quote that includes good prep, communication, and careful installation can be the better deal over time.
